....And You Will Know Us By The Trail Of Dead
Ok, I saw them once at the Fillmore in San Francisco. They dominate for about 45 mins/an hour, and then they tear apart the whole stage. The lead singer Conrad Keely shatters a half-full bottle of wine against the back wall of the stage. After about 2 minutes of destruction, they finally stop...Conrad asks the audience "Does anyone know where the bass drum pedal is?" It gets found, and they continue playing for another half hour. Just a little side story. Pantera was the "house" band of the club my friends and I went to growing up. It was a room about 1000 square feet. We thought they were great, but never considered them anything other than local. I bet we saw them 100 times. That seems a lifetime ago.
